Summary of the Introduced Bill

HB 921 -- State Payroll Checks

Co-Sponsors:  Curls, Thompson, Shelton, Smith, Troupe, Williams,
Bowman, Coleman

This bill compels any state or federally-chartered bank, savings
and loan, or credit union to cash any payroll check issued to a
state employee.  The employee is not required to be a customer
of the institution where the check is presented for cashing.
When the employee is not a customer of the institution, the
institution may charge a check-cashing fee not to exceed the
check cashing fee assessed to its customers.  Institutions that
violate the provisions of the bill would be subject to potential
administrative penalties not to exceed $5,000 per violation.
